資料建模:它是一種為資料庫定義業務需求的技術。
優點:1、資料模型有助於分析員快速地確定業務詞彙(比過程模型確定的更全面)
2、資料模型幾乎總是比過程模型構造得快
3、乙個完整的資料模型可以記錄在一張紙上,而過程模型則常常需要十幾頁紙
4、過程建模人員經常而且也很容易陷入不必要的細節中,
5、現有系統和建議系統的資料模型之間的相似性遠比他們的過程模型之間的相似性高。這種相似性在你進入後續階段的工作時使得較少的工作被丟棄。
1、在系統計畫和分析期間
2、儲存在資料庫中
1、實體關係圖(erd)定義:是一種利用符號記法按照資料描述的實體和關係來刻畫資料的資料模型
實體:指某些事物,企業需要儲存有關這些事物的資料。
屬性:是實體的描述性性質或特徵。
資料型別:是屬性的乙個引數,定義了這個屬性中額可以儲存什麼型別的資料。
域:是屬性的乙個引數,定義了這個屬性可以取的合法值。
預設值:是如果使用者沒有制定值的話將被記錄的值
鍵:是乙個屬性(或一組屬性),它們對每乙個實體實力具有乙個唯一的值。有時也稱作識別符號。
關係:是存在於乙個或多個實體之間的自然業務聯絡。
基數:定義了乙個實體相對於另乙個關聯實體之間的摸個具體值的最大和最小具體值數量。
讀書:是參與那個關係的實體數量。
1、獲取實體
2、上下文資料模型
3、基於鍵的資料模型
4、泛化層次體系
5、具有完整屬性的資料模型
出處:
《系統分析與設計方法》 第8章 資料建模
資料建模 它是一種為資料庫定義業務需求的技術。優點 1 資料模型有助於分析員快速地確定業務詞彙 比過程模型確定的更全面 2 資料模型幾乎總是比過程模型構造得快 3 乙個完整的資料模型可以記錄在一張紙上,而過程模型則常常需要十幾頁紙 4 過程建模人員經常而且也很容易陷入不必要的細節中,5 現有系統和建...
《系統分析與設計方法》 第8章 資料建模
資料建模 它是一種為資料庫定義業務需求的技術。優點 1 資料模型有助於分析員快速地確定業務詞彙 比過程模型確定的更全面 2 資料模型幾乎總是比過程模型構造得快 3 乙個完整的資料模型可以記錄在一張紙上,而過程模型則常常需要十幾頁紙 4 過程建模人員經常而且也很容易陷入不必要的細節中,5 現有系統和建...
《系統分析與設計方法》 第9章 過程建模
系統建模 將非結構化的問題結構話,對現有系統構造模型或對建議的系統構造模型,以便更好了解現有系統或作為記錄業務需求或技術設計的方法。邏輯建模 是描述系統是什麼或者系統做什麼的非技術性的圖形化表示。物理模型 是展示系統是什麼或者系統做什麼,以及系統如何實現的技術性的圖形化表示。閱讀並解釋資料流圖 資料...